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

 

Powrót do spisu komponentów: Plus GUS

Przykładowa mapa procesu: GUS_TEST 2017-04-21.zip

Przeznaczenie:

 Zadanie automatyczne służy do pobierania danych o podmiocie gospodarczym z Głównego Urzędu Statystycznego (GUS). Możemy wyszukać dane za pomocą  1 z  3 parametrów (NIP/REGON?KRS).

Parametry:

 

Image Removed

Parametry Wejściowe:

"Typ parametru wyszukiwania"

Typ pola STRING. Rodzaj numeru za pomocą którego będą wyszukiwane dane w GUS'ie. Pole może przyjąć jedną z 3 wartości: "NIP", "REGON", "KRS".

"Wartość parametru szukania"

Typ pola STRING. Konkretny wartość numeru za pomocą którego będą wyszukiwane dane w GUS'ie.

 

Parametry Wyjściowe:

"Nazwa"

Typ pola VARIABLE.  Nazwa podmiotu gospodarczego z systemu GUS.

"Ulica [opcjonalnie]"

Typ pola VARIABLE.  Nazwa ulicy  z systemu GUS.

"Kod Pocztowy [opcjonalnie]"

Typ pola VARIABLE.  Kod pocztowy podmiotu gospodarczego z systemu GUS.

"Miasto [opcjonalnie]"

Typ pola VARIABLE.  Nazwa miejscowości podmiotu gospodarczego z systemu GUS.

"Województwo [Opcjonalnie]"

Typ pola VARIABLE.  Nazwa województwa podmiotu gospodarczego z systemu GUS.

"Gmina [Opcjonalnie]"

Typ pola VARIABLE.  Nazwa gminy podmiotu gospodarczego z systemu GUS.

"Powiat [Opcjonalnie] "

Typ pola VARIABLE.  Nazwa powiatu podmiotu gospodarczego z systemu GUS.

"SilosID Opis [Opcjonalnie]"

Typ pola VARIABLE. Opis  kodu zawracanego   z systemu GUS

"Typ jednostki opis [Opcjonalnie]"

Typ pola VARIABLE. Opis  kodu zawracanego   z systemu GUS

"NIP [Opcjonalnie]"

Typ pola VARIABLE. Zwracany numer NIP w przypadku szukania po REGON lub KRS. Dla parametru szukania "NIP" pole zostanie uzupełniona wartością szukaną

"REGON [Opcjonalnie]"

Typ pola VARIABLE. Zwracany numer REGON w przypadku szukania po NIP lub KRS. Dla parametru szukania "REGON" pole zostanie uzupełniona wartością szukaną.

Szczegółowy opis działania:

Zadanie automatyczne po wcześniejszej konfiguracji wtyczki łączy się z  zewnętrznym systemem GUS.  Na podstawie parametrów wejściowych próbuje odczytać dane z tego systemu. Opcjonalnie możemy wybrać jakie pobrane dane maja zostać zaciągnięte do procesu. W tym celu należy skonfigurować odpowiednie parametry wyjściowe zadania automatycznego.  W momencie gdy system GUS nie znajdzie odpowiedniego podmiotu gospodarczego lub wystąpi jakiś problem (np brak połączenia z usługą) informacja ta zostanie wyświetlona w komentarzu do zadania.

Przykład:

Konfiguracja:

Image Removed

Wyniki:

Image Removed

 Jeśli masz problem ze zrozumieniem jak działa setter/zadanie automatyczne, sprawdź opisy: SetterZadanie automatyczneWykonanie warunkoweParametry komponentów

Opis 

Zadanie automatyczne/setter pobierane dane o podmiocie gospodarczym z systemu zew. GUS.   Dane pobrane są przechowywane w pamięci serwera (cache). Tak więc system nie pobiera ciągle tych samych danych z GUS. 

Info
titleCache

Dane są wynikowe z WebService są przechowywane przez 24 godzin i maksymalnie 144000 wyniki

 

Parametry konfiguracyjne

Parametry wejściowe:

Nazwa parametruOd wersjiOpisTyp parametruWartość domyślnaRodzaj polaUwagi i ograniczenia
Szukana wartość*  Wartość dla której pobrane zostaną dane (Np nr NIP)Teks   
Szukany typ* Typ wartości powyżejTekstNIPLista rozwijanaWybór 1 z 3 (KRS,NIP,REGON)

Parametr*- pole wymagane

 

Parametry wyjściowe:

Nazwa parametruOd wersjiOpisTyp parametruWartość domyślnaRodzaj polaUwagi i ograniczenia
Nazwa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
Ulica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
Kod pocztowy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
Miejscowość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
Województwo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
Gmina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
Powiat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
SilosID opis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
Typ opis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
NIP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 
REGON Pole do zapisu pobranych danych z GUSZmienna nagłówkowa Pole edytowalne 

 

 Przykładowa konfiguracja 

Image Added